102 Not Out is a charming, stage-play-style movie that manages to be deeply moving without being a total downer. It’s essentially a two-man show featuring two of India’s greatest actors, and they carry the film with a mix of slapstick energy and genuine pathos.
If you're tired of the 'grumpy grandpa' stereotype, this is the antidote. It's clean, smart, and will likely make you want to call your parents the second the credits roll. It's a great pick for a multi-generational movie night.
